EFE Trenes de Chile modernizes services with Siemens Mobility technology

EFE Trenes de Chile has modernized its long-distance services through the implementation of S3 Passenger, a digital platform developed by Sqills, a subsidiary of Siemens Mobility. The deployment, which began operating on July 22, marks the first use of this technology in South America and was completed within a six-month period.

The platform utilizes artificial intelligence to enable dynamic fare management, inventory control, and streamlined reservations. Passengers can now enjoy greater autonomy by managing their own bookings, selecting specific seats, adding extra luggage, traveling with pets, or purchasing food and category upgrades. The system also facilitates managing connecting trips through a single purchase.

Beyond passenger convenience, the digitalization aims to reduce manual processes at stations, allowing staff to focus more on direct user assistance. The platform also includes accessibility features designed for passengers using wheelchairs or those with specific needs to ensure safer and more comfortable travel.
